BUT HOW BEST TO SELECT THE RIGHT PERSON OR FIRM TO REPRESENT YOU AND YOUR GOALS:
If you have not used a Professional Estate Agent before, and do not know where to start, it is helpful to have some general guidelines.
MAKE SURE TO CHOOSE A REAL ESTATE PROFESSIONAL, WHO:
WORKS FULL-TIME
While there are many part-time real estate professionals out there, it is advisable to choose a full-time Broker or Agent. If you choose a person who handles real estate transactions only on week-ends, or a few days in a week, you run the risk of missing out on many opportunities
EXPERIENCE
Make sure to pick an experienced Real Estate Professional. Inquire how may real estate transactions he or she typically handles each year. The more seasoned the professional, the smoother your real estate transaction will be.
IS LIKEABLE AND TRUSTWORTHY
As with any other business relationship, your broker should be someone you feel comfortable with. He or she should be confident, easy to talk to, and trustworthy. This person will play a large role in the future of your business so make sure to engage someone who has a clear understanding of your goals.
